You may want to do a little research on screens, before recommending them. They are usually between 40% - 45% closed, this means the surface area to actual intake will need to be much larger to possibly get full flow. Has nothing to do with dirt or dust. Putting a screen on the inlet of that turbo is killing its flow potential

Nice man, 7670 on the N54 is really responsive. Good bottom end and will pull to redline. 19psi on pump at 7K redline is the speed limit of the turbo, not sure you'll get 500 out of that but you'll go well into the 400's on a dynojet.

Yep. The bw matchbot seems suggest the same. Mine is auto, so it won't rev to 7k. 20psi is what @CKI@Motiv and I are aiming for with pump. Apparently the Supra guys can get over 500whp on just 15 psi, so hopefully n54 won't be too far behind with a less efficient head.

19 at 7K might be somewhat conservative, their matchbot is assuming a 105% VE spec at 7K which sounds high. 20psi sounds good, I'm at 14.5psi at 7K so far on a clients car and we're at ~410whp on 93

Quick update. Running into some problem with the fitment of the manifold and downpipe.

The shop who is working on my car just found out on Thurs that the v-band connecting the bank 1 and bank 2 manifold is short by almost 1/4". Not sure how that happened since everything fit on the mockup engine at ACF prior to ceramic coating (as you can see from my previous post). Have to cut off the vband flange and reweld it. Both my mechanic and ACF thinks the ceramic coating somehow shrunk or wrapped the manifold. But I am having hard time picturing these thick 321 stainless steel piping can be wrapped so easily...

Downpipe is also off by almost 1/2" at the mid-pipe side (sitting way too low). We have to make a new one by scratch to fix that since the downpipe that ACF made me is also rubbing on the wiring harness at the top as well. There is just no way to make the current one work, especially with the recirculated dump pipes.

Good news. Hood clearance is good. The subframe was bolted back in today and we were able to close the hood without hitting the turbo.

Pretty disappointed at the moment, since I was promised a plug-n-play kit with minimal additional fabrication involved. The weld and the craftsmanship for each parts is top notch, but they are no good if then don't fit together.
